摘要
In wireless power transfer systems, the leakage magnetic field must be kept below a certain specified value, as it can affect the human body or electronic devices in the vicinity. Consequently, many studies have been conducted to reduce the leakage magnetic fields in wireless power transfer systems. This paper aims to minimize the generation of unnecessary magnetic fields by arranging multiple transmitter coils and activating only specific transmitter coils that correspond to the position or size of the receiver coil. It analyzes the magnitude of the current depending on the number of activated transmitter coils and the resulting size of the leakage magnetic field, and discusses a method for selecting transmitter coils to minimize the leakage magnetic field. The proposed method has been verified to reduce the magnetic field by about 53% in a 300 W class WPT system compared to using a single TX.
